I basically want a way to redraw my script gui every time the user changes
the selected object. Even if scriptlinks had this event, they don't allow
Draw.Register and neither do the (very cool btw) spacehandler scripts.
Instead it would be useful to have an event handler for object selection
change (or even other things such as enter/exit editmode, etc.) This will
allow gui's to become much more responsive to the user and thereby much more
user-friendly.
